St. Louis County Has New Logo

County Executive Dr. Sam Page unveiled Saint Louis County’s new logo and branding at today’s State of the County address.
“The logo serves as a cohesive symbol of Saint Louis County, bringing our brand tagline “Opportunity Central” to life,”

Dr. Page said. “Our region’s population has been stagnant for decades. We can’t compete against ourselves. We must work

as one. We want the Austins, the Nashvilles, and the other metro regions that have done a fine job of branding themselves

know that we see you, but we are also competing with you.”
This new branding will have a number of wide-reaching effects. It will give a stronger and more consistent voice for all county

governmental agency communications. It will more effectively promote Saint Louis County as a desirable destination for visitors,

businesses and future residents alike. And it better represents the current values of the county while positioning us well for the future.
The new logo for the county combines two, traditional St. Louis elements: The first is a fleur-de-lis, a nod to our area’s French history

and heritage. The second element is this woven circle design. This represents the Missouri, Mississippi and Merman rivers that

border our county, but it also speaks to the partnership between the government and its people, the county and its municipalities,

as well as the balance of work and life. It’s a reminder that only through collaboration can Saint Louis County continue to move toward

prosperity. Paired with our new county logo is a new county slogan: Opportunity Central. This line speaks to the many possibilities

the county holds for people of all kinds. It serves as an invitation for businesses to come and thrive, a call for families to make their

homes here or a destination for visitors to come to relax, learn, eat, play and more.
